Invention Grant
- Patent Title: Data consistency within a federation infrastructure
- Patent Title (中): 联合基础设施内的数据一致性
-
Application No.: US11936556Application Date: 2007-11-07
-
Publication No.: US08090880B2Publication Date: 2012-01-03
- Inventor: Richard L. Hasha , Lu Xun , Gopala Krishna R. Kakivaya , Dahlia Malkhi
- Applicant: Richard L. Hasha , Lu Xun , Gopala Krishna R. Kakivaya , Dahlia Malkhi
- Applicant Address: US WA Redmond
- Assignee: Microsoft Corporation
- Current Assignee: Microsoft Corporation
- Current Assignee Address: US WA Redmond
- Agency: Workman Nydegger
- Main IPC: G06F15/16
- IPC: G06F15/16 ; G06F15/173 ; G06F17/00 ; G06F11/16

Abstract:
In some embodiments, it is determined that a primary node has been elected from among a plurality of nodes in a replica set of nodes. The primary node accepts and processes client data access requests. The replica set includes the primary node and other secondary nodes. The primary node receives client data access requests. The primary node assigns a data sequence number to each client data access request that mutates state in the order the client data access requests are received. The data sequence numbers include a linearized processing order that is to be followed by each of the nodes in the replica set. The primary node sends the mutating client data access requests including any corresponding data sequence numbers to the secondary nodes. The primary node receives, from a threshold number of secondary nodes, an acknowledgement indicating reception of the client data access request. The primary node commits the data mutating access request.
Public/Granted literature
- US20080288646A1 DATA CONSISTENCY WITHIN A FEDERATION INFRASTRUCTURE Public/Granted day:2008-11-20
Information query